Sir Bob Parker moved to long-term care facility

Sir Bob Parker Photo: Supplied/ Office of the Governor General. Sir Bob is in a wheelchair with limited movement on his left side. He spent time in Burwood Hospital before moving to the long-term facility last week. His long- time friend Bert Govan said Sir Bob s illness had come as a shock to family and friends. He said Sir Bob and his wife, Lady Jo Nicholls-Parker, were keeping very active and cycling regularly, until Sir Bob s health declined. It s just the last thing that was expected, but I think they ll also be very proud of the way that Bob and Jo have dug deep, and are really working with the medical teams to give him the best chance of rehabilitation.

Sir Bob Parker digging in after heart attack and stroke

Sir Bob Parker was the public face of the Christchurch earthquake response. Former Christchurch mayor Sir Bob Parker is in a long-term care facility after a life-threatening stroke left him with limited movement and confined to a wheelchair. Parker, a national television figure before becoming an inspiring frontman in the aftermath of the earthquakes in 2010 and 2011 in Canterbury, said he suffered a heart attack in May last year, when he was feeling as “fit as he had ever been”. The 68-year-old was treated and received medication, including blood thinning drugs. After recovering, he had a stroke on October 5, just days after attending an event in Akaroa to mark the restoration of its historic lighthouse.
